Pros

Unlimited PTO was a nice perk

Cons

They micro managed people a lot, are not good with documentation so any new hire has to learn as he goes and guess or ask a lot of questions to figure out system

Pros

Awesome management, excellent work life balance and high expectations. Absolutely LOVED my role here, my team and my boss. They expect a lot and will treat you right if you are a hard worker and honest employee.

Cons

I resigned after a change in CSuite leadership (CEO, President of our Department etc), and other layoffs I felt changes were coming and wanted to get ahead of those. I resigned however loved working for Red River and would work for them again if the opportunity presented itself. True professionals.
